Gulf Coast Trades Center / Raven School (GCTC) is a charter boarding school located in unincorporated Walker County, Texas, near New Waverly.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] The school, operated by the nonprofit agency Gulf Coast Trades Center Inc., [ 3 ] is in proximity to Houston .

Northwest Lineman College, founded in 1993, is a private vocational technical college offering training programs with a concentration on careers in the power delivery industry. The main campus is located in Meridian, Idaho and branch campuses are located in Oroville, California , Denton, Texas and Edgewater, Florida.

ATI Enterprises, also known as ATI Schools and Colleges [1] and ATI Training Center, [2] was a group of career training schools operating in the southern and western United States. The company imploded in 2013 under a burden of multiple lawsuits, legal claims and financial issues.
